MFC 生成 exe文件的图标更改方法(转)
来源:互联网 发布:xbox360手柄链接mac 编辑:程序博客网 时间:2024/05/22 03:26
http://blog.sina.com.cn/s/blog_6719cf530100s80g.html
创建或打开工程Icon(以下都以工程名为Icon为例)。
另一位网友总结的方法:
VC6.0生成的exe文件图标是用Icon下几个图标中value值最小的,顺序为IDR_MAINFRAME、IDR_ICONTETYPE、新加的,所以想更改生成的exe文件图标,只要保证图标的value值是Icon下几个图标中最小的就可以了。
如果生成的exe文件不想用VC自带的MFC图标,可以进行如下操作:
方法一、最简单的方法
1、在程序res文件夹下,删除MFC图标文件,加入自己的图标文件;
2、在图标IDR_MAINFRAME的属性对话框中,修改File name路径为自己的图标文件。
注:(1)一定要先删除原文件,否则会把你的图标文件覆盖掉;
方法二:
1、在资源视图Icon下加入想用的图标;
2、修改该图标的value值,把值改为Icon下几个图标中最小的:
(1)方法一:打开Header Files下的Resource.h,找到Icon下的图标,系统默认是从128开始的,
#define
#define IDR_ICONTETYPE
#define
#define
可以修改全部的value值,也可以只修改想用的图标,只要保证value值是Icon下几个图标中最小的就可以;
(2)方法二:在图标的属性对话框中,在ID后面加上=value,比如IDI_ICON1=127,也要保证value值是Icon下几个图标中最小的。
方法三:
1、在资源视图中删除Icon下的IDR_MAINFRAME和IDR_ICONTETYPE;
2、加入想用的图标,可以改名为IDR_MAINFRAME,也可以不改;
3、如果不改名为IDR_MAINFRAME,则在程序中要修改相应的代码:
基于对话框的程序,在构造函数中有一句
m_hIcon = AfxGetApp()->LoadIcon(IDR_MAINFRAME);
记得把IDR_MAINFRAME改为你自己的图标名。
- MFC 生成 exe文件的图标更改方法(转)
- MFC 生成 exe文件的图标更改方法(转)
- MFC 生成 exe文件的图标更改方法(转)
- MFC 生成 exe文件的图标更改方法(转)
- MFC生成exe文件图标更改方法
- MFC 生成 exe文件的图标更改方法
- MFC中对生成exe文件的图标更改方法
- MFC 生成 exe文件的图标更改方法
- MFC 生成 exe文件的图标更改方法
- MFC 生成 exe文件的图标更改方法
- MFC 生成 exe文件的图标更改…
- 更改MFC生成的程序的默认exe图标
- 更改MFC标题栏图标和生成的执行文件图标
- 更改MFC标题栏图标和生成的执行文件图标
- 更改MFC标题栏图标和生成的执行文件图标
- 更改MFC生成的程序的默认exe图标(转)
- VC6.0更改生成的exe文件图标
- VC6.0更改生成的exe文件图标
- 解决QT程序CPU占用率高(setStyleSheet)
- sql删除表内所有数据 修改自动增长列起始值
- 深航遭虚假恐怖信息威胁案疑犯可能获刑超5年-民航局-虚假-信息
- 非整数倍率YUV422图像的自由缩放算法
- linux系统各个文件夹的介绍(未完善)
- MFC 生成 exe文件的图标更改方法(转)
- 对inout端口的理解
- Ponsole让C#控制台程序更漂亮的类库
- java序列化
- Android下通过root实现对system_server中binder的ioctl调用拦截
- 爱了就不后悔
- 如果有一天我不再烦你,你会想我吗?
- 执子之手、与子偕老
- 蝴蝶飞不过沧海